Mybatis inexpression
WebThese methods are used to execute SELECT, INSERT, UPDATE and DELETE statements that are defined in your SQL Mapping XML files. They are pretty self explanatory, each takes the ID of the statement and the Parameter Object, which can be a primitive (auto-boxed or wrapper), a JavaBean, a POJO or a Map. WebMay 26, 2024 · MyBatis is an open source persistence framework which simplifies the implementation of database access in Java applications. It provides the support for …
Mybatis inexpression
Did you know?
WebMar 18, 2015 · By Arvind Rai, March 18, 2015. MyBatis 3. In this page, we will provide MyBatis 3 annotation example with @Select, @Insert, @Update and @Delete. These … WebMay 26, 2024 · MyBatis is an open source persistence framework which simplifies the implementation of database access in Java applications. It provides the support for custom SQL, stored procedures and different types of mapping relations. Simply put, it's an alternative to JDBC and Hibernate. 2. Maven Dependencies.
WebAug 9, 2024 · MyBatis-Mate 为 mp 企业级模块,支持分库分表,数据审计、数据敏感词过滤(AC算法),字段加密,字典回写(数据绑定),数据权限,表结构自动生成 SQL 维护等,旨在更敏捷优雅处理数据。 ... InExpression inExpression = new InExpression(new Column(dataColumn.getAliasDotName ... WebApr 11, 2024 · The second method to return the TOP (n) rows is with ROW_NUMBER (). If you've read any of my other articles on window functions, you know I love it. The syntax below is an example of how this would work. ;WITH cte_HighestSales AS ( SELECT ROW_NUMBER() OVER (PARTITION BY FirstTableId ORDER BY Amount DESC) AS …
WebAnnotation Interface Intercepts. @Documented @Retention ( RUNTIME ) @Target ( TYPE ) public @interface Intercepts. The annotation that specify target methods to intercept. WebApr 22, 2024 · MyBatis mapper: @Update ("UPDATE demo SET status = # {status.value} WHERE id= # {uuid}") long updateStatus (@Param ("status") Status status, @Param ("uuid") String uuid); And the Java Enum: public enum Status { ACTIVE ("A"), INACTIVE ("I"); Status (final String value) { this.value = value; } public String getValue () { return value; } }
WebMar 24, 2016 · SpringBoot MyBatis starter provides the following MyBatis configuration parameters which we can use to customize MyBatis settings. 6. 1. mybatis.config = mybatis config file name. 2. mybatis ...
Weblass="nolink">内置分页插件: 基于 MyBatis 物理分页,开发者无需关心具体操作,配置好插件之后,写分页等同于普通 List 查询 "nolink">分页插件支持多种数据库: 支持 MySQL … tivoli ghostWebJul 29, 2024 · MyBatis is one of the most commonly used open-source frameworks for implementing SQL databases access in Java applications. In this quick tutorial, we'll … tivoli gm monogramWebApr 2, 2016 · I have the same issue with MyBatis 3.4.0, using Spring 4.3.0.RELEASE and MyBatis-Spring 1.3.0. On server start, the first requests fails; but execute correctly the same requests after. The property name change randomly. tivoli gazeboWebApr 11, 2024 · Mybatis-plus插件的一次完美实践,最近再做项目的时候遇到一个需求,系统中的数据按照行政区代码进行分隔,简单来说 ... Expression where) { //获得where条件表 … tivoli garden jamaicaWebSummary. Public Constructors. ExpressionEvaluator () Public Methods. boolean. evaluateBoolean (String expression, Object parameterObject) Iterable. evaluateIterable … tivoli gdanskWebApr 5, 2024 · MyBatis 的强大特性之一便是它的动态 SQL。通常使用动态 SQL 不可能是独立的一部分,MyBatis 当然使用一种强大的动态 SQL 语言来改进这种情形,这种语言可以被用在任意的 SQL 映射语句中。MyBatis 采用功能强大的基于 OGNL 的表达式来消除其他元素。常用元素SQL片段:有时候可以通过将部分代码抽出来作为 ... tivoli gdnWebNov 25, 2014 · This can done in mybatis-velocity by defining custom directive which will dynamically create org.apache.ibatis.mapping.ParameterMapping. It may be used in mapper like this: insert into ot ( #field_names ('com.atos.tables.Table1') ) values ( @ {id}, #params_for_fields ('com.atos.tables.Table1') ) tivoli gm size